
Google Now can be just easily accessed in Android devices with on-screen navigation keys by just swiping it up from the bottom of the home button. Obviously it is one of the greatest advantage of Android devices as it enables us to directly jump into Google Now from anywhere in the OS.
Unfortunately this small feature can end up causing a headache for many people. You may accidentally open Google Now while playing games in your Android devices.
(Google Now Swipe Disabler) developed by Adrian Campos had proved to be handy to avoid this problem. This application does not require root access to work properly and it is quite easy to use. This application can be used either to replace the stock swipe up to Google Now action with any other app or to completely disable it.
Step 1 : First download the application (Google Now swipe disabler) and install it on your Android device. This application can run properly on all Android devices which has on-screen navigation keys. It can work well in HTC One as it has swipe up to open Google Now action.

Step 2 : After installing the Google Now swipe disabler select the chose action option, which then present you with a list of all your installed apps and gives you an option to assign any action to the gesture. This app comes handy as it allow you to open any other app. While on disabling the Google Now function, you can allow any other function to replace that to run your desired application.
Step 3 : Once you have configured the desired action, return back on to the home screen. When you first swipe up the home screen action, for the first time you will be promoted to an option to “Complete the action using” pop-up. Now select the 'Google Now Swipe Disabler' from the pop-up and set it as a default option. By doing this you have changed the the Android's default action of opening the Google Now with any thier action that was being configured by you.
